Encountering a disagreement with your insurance company can be a frustrating experience. But, by following a methodical approach, you can increase your chances of achieving a favorable outcome. Begin by carefully scrutinizing your policy documents to understand your benefits. Record all communication with the insurance company, including dates, times, and names of individuals you speak with. Should you are finding it difficult to resolve the dispute amicably, consider obtaining legal counsel. A qualified attorney can assist you through the legal process and advocate on your behalf.

  • Maintain detailed records of all relevant information, including emails, invoices, as well as any other supporting evidence.
  • Understand your policy's terms and conditions to determine your legal standing.
  • Interact with the insurance company in a professional and respectful manner.

Navigating Your Insurance Claim: Strategies for Success

Securing a successful settlement from your insurance claim can feel like navigating a labyrinth. Don't fret! By following these key approaches, you can maximize your chances of a positive conclusion. First and foremost, meticulously review your policy documents. Familiarize yourself with the nuances regarding your coverage limits and the process for filing a claim. Promptly report any incident to your insurance company, providing them with complete information about the situation.

Keep detailed records of all correspondence with your insurer, including dates, times, and parties involved. Photograph any damage or injuries relevant to your claim. This evidence will be crucial in proving your case.

Consider reaching out to an experienced insurance specialist. They can guide you through the process, negotiate your best interests, and help ensure a fair resolution. Remember, being persistent and knowledgeable is essential for securing a successful insurance claim.

Understanding Your Policy and Rights in an Insurance Dispute

Navigating an insurance dispute can be a complex process. It's crucial to carefully review your agreement documents to understand the terms, conditions, and coverage limits that apply to your situation.

Your policy will outline the detailed circumstances under which your insurer is required to deliver coverage. It's also important to become yourself with your legal entitlements as an insured party. These rights may include the ability to challenge a rejection of coverage or request a formal review of your claim.

If you encounter difficulties understanding your policy or believe your rights have been infringed, it's advisable to speak with an experienced insurance broker. They can help you in deciphering your policy language and consider available alternatives to resolve the dispute.

Navigating Disagreements with Your Insurance Company

When arguments arise with your insurance provider, clear and concise communication is paramount. Begin by carefully reviewing your policy documents to understand your coverage and any relevant exclusions. Record all interactions with the insurance company, including dates, times, names of representatives, and summary. When contacting the provider, remain calm and professional. Articulate your concerns in a logical manner, providing supporting evidence where applicable. Be persistent in pursuing a fair resolution. If you experience difficulty settling the issue directly with the provider, consider appealing your case to their customer service department or an independent insurance ombudsman.

Frequent Insurance Claim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them

Filing an insurance claim can be a tricky process, and navigating it successfully requires careful attention to detail. There are numerous common pitfalls that claimants often fall into, which can lead to delays or even denials. To ensure a smooth claims process, it's essential to understand these potential problems and take steps to avoid them.

One frequent mistake is submitting an incomplete application. Be sure to provide all the necessary information and documentation, as missing details can cause your claim being delayed. It's also crucial to inform your insurer about any changes to your details promptly. Failure to do so could void your coverage and leave you unprotected in case of a future occurrence.

Another common pitfall is overstating the extent of your losses. While it's understandable to want to receive full compensation, being dishonest about damages can lead serious problems. Your insurer has ways to authenticate claims, and any discrepancies will likely lead to a denied claim or even legal action.

Remember, honesty and openness are key when dealing with insurance claims. By avoiding these common pitfalls and following best practices, you can increase your chances of a smooth outcome.
